Beyond Profits: ESG, Corporate Governance, and the Future of Inclusive Tech

Date: 20 September 2023, 15:45 - 17:45
Location: DWF Leeds; Bridgewater Place, 1 Water Ln, Holbeck, Leeds LS11 5DY
0098 Responsible Business WT Banner 767 x 431

We are pleased to release the programme for our panel session, brought to you in collaboration with Leeds Digital Festival, Beyond Profits: ESG, Corporate Governance, and the Future of Inclusive Tech.

Event Details


As technology continues to revolutionise industries, there is a growing need to evaluate its impact through an ESG lens. 

Our panellists will delve into the role of ESG considerations in the mid-market technology sector, including:

  • the pivotal role corporate governance plays in in shaping the ethical and responsible behaviour of organisations, best practices for fostering a culture of transparency, accountability, and ethical leadership; 
  • the challenges and opportunities that arise when integrating ESG factors into investment decisions, investment readiness and supply chain requirements;
  • how to actively promote social mobility, diversity, and inclusion within your workforce. From breaking down barriers to providing equal opportunities.
